#BikeNite A8:
The best photo from this week was from my ride on the Root River State Trail on Tuesday. You can see the curve of the bluff, trail and river. This is a must ride trail in the driftless area of Southeast Minnesota. Come ride it if you're ever in this neck of the woods.
